This book traces the past, present and future of alternative graphic design at the hands of a multidisciplinary and international design community and its artistic and community-building practices at A—Z Presents, a Berlin-based space for experimental graphic design. Assuming the form of an "index for alternative graphic design," the book offers a comprehensive view of the wide range of activities performed by a multitude of graphic designers and visual artists from diverse backgrounds, ages and career standings in the past six years. The first part, "A—Z," features all the activities and events initiated by A—Z, with contributions from designers like Na Kim, Niklaus Troxler and the Rodina, and over 100 entries in between. The second part, titled "—?," features 32 international designers, including April Greiman, Richard Niessen and Loraine Furter, to envision the future of graphic design.
